WebOct 13, 2024 · CMS (Cisco Meeting Server) is our leading Video Conferencing (MCU) solution offering: - secure video meetings (PIN protection, encryption). - integration with … chad hydraulicsWebOct 28, 2024 · Note: The maxPeerVideoStreams is only relevant in a CMS Cluster of two or more servers, it is not relevant with a single CMS server. If maxPeerVideoStreams is not set, the default behavior of CMS is to send a maximum of 4 video streams over a distributed call to the other CMS server, this was the behavior prior to CMS 2.3.
